ISB Series App Note: A Refresher on Smart Busbar Sensing

Need a better way to sense current on busbars? Let’s revisit the ISB Series Current Sense Transducer. This compact sensor is a smart alternative to bulky, traditional sensors. It delivers high performance with fast response and high bandwidth.

A custom ASIC-based Hall effect device powers the ISB series. It operates without a traditional core and winding. This core-less design is the key to provide a lower-cost solution. It delivers fast response, high bandwidth, high isolation, and performance sitting between open-loop and closed-loop designs.

It’s designed for currents from 75 A up to over 670 A and is easy to install in applications with tight dimensional constraints.

Key Design Features You Can Leverage

Our ISB Series App Note (ISB-AN1-R1) details the ISB’s smart features. These features solve common engineering challenges.

  • Concentrates Magnetic Flux: The shield provides a path of lower magnetic resistance. This concentrates the magnetic flux density. This helps the sensor measure low current levels.
  • Protects from EMI: The shield also helps protect the sensor from stray EMI fields from adjacent high-current paths.

Total Design Flexibility

The ISB series is built for easy integration:

  • Connection Options: Choose between a compact header connector (8.5 mm creepage) or a lead-wire version (158.5 mm creepage) for much higher isolation.
  • Programmable Ranges: We can factory program custom current ranges. This includes unsymmetrical ranges (e.g., -100 A to +300 A).
  • Simplified Integration: A reference output is available, providing a stable voltage at 50% of VDD to simplify driving an op-amp circuit.

ITP Series: Toroidal Inductors for High Current Applications

[Marietta, GA] – ICE Components, Inc., a leading global manufacturer of power electronic components, today announced the availability of its new ITP Series of High Current Toroidal Inductors.  This series is designed to meet the rigorous demands of high-current power applications, offering exceptional performance and reliability.

The ITP Series inductors are ideal for use in a wide range of applications, including:

  • DC/DC converters
  • Power supplies
  • Inverters
  • Renewable energy systems
  • Industrial equipment

Key Features and Benefits:

  • High Current Handling: The ITP Series is engineered to handle high current levels, making them suitable for demanding power circuits.
  • Toroidal Core Construction: Offers superior EMI performance compared to other inductor types.
  • Low Core Loss: Improves efficiency and reduces heat generation.
  • Compact Size: Provides a space-saving solution for high-density designs.
  • RoHS Compliant: Meets environmental regulations.
